Why This Transfer Matters for Market Liquidity

Dormant wallet movements are closely watched by traders because they signal potential selling pressure. The 10 BTC, valued at over half a million dollars, could be moved to an exchange for sale, or it could be a consolidation into a new wallet for custody reasons. Without on-chain attribution, the intent remains unclear, but the timing—just ahead of major Bitcoin conferences—adds intrigue.

Historically, when very old coins move, it often precedes increased market activity. For instance, in early 2026, a similar 2011-era transfer of 50 BTC preceded a 4% price dip within 48 hours. However, not all movements lead to sell-offs; some are transfers to cold storage or estate planning. Who Is Exposed and What Could Change the Thesis

Long-term holders who have been waiting for a signal to take profits may interpret this movement as a cue to do the same. Conversely, institutional investors looking for entry points might view the potential supply increase as a buying opportunity if prices dip. The immediate risk is a short-term price drop if the 10 BTC are sent to an exchange and sold.

However, the amount is relatively small compared to daily trading volumes, which average $30 billion on major exchanges. A $500,000 sell would be a drop in the bucket, unlikely to move the market beyond a few basis points. The psychological impact, though, could be larger, as it reminds traders of the massive unrealized gains held by early adopters.
